Why this matters
Why now

Advances in large language models and autonomous execution capabilities are enabling AI agents to tackle increasingly complex, multi-step business processes like payroll and HR, moving beyond simple task automation.

Why it’s important

This development indicates a nearing inflection point where AI can independently manage core business functions, potentially redefining work and the competitive landscape for SaaS providers and service industries.

What changes

The operational paradigm for small and medium-sized businesses could shift from human intervention in routine administrative tasks to autonomous AI management, freeing up human capital for strategic activities.
